
On August 29th, the energy at Main Stage was electric as we hosted the very first Main Stage Hip-Hop Showdown, a night dedicated to celebrating Hamilton’s hip-hop talent and culture. The event brought together rappers, producers, and supporters from across the city for an unforgettable evening of music, competition, and community.
The Showdown featured two rounds: one for rappers and one for producers. Each performer had 10 minutes to showcase their best work, and the crowd matched every beat with unstoppable energy. The judges: Dejehan “Luckystickz” Hamilton, BLK Orchid, and Main Stage’s own Justin Dobbin had the tough task of choosing the winners, with so much talent hitting the stage. BLK Orchid also gave us a stunning surprise performance.
After an intense night of performances, we’re excited to congratulate our winners:
- Best Rapper: RAXX
- Best Producer: Amarelle Ruth Hall
Both winners earned themselves a trophy, serious bragging rights, and the respect of Hamilton’s hip-hop community. We also want to give a big thanks to all the other talented competitors who made the night special:
